When you are plugged into shore power, and the converter is working, the panel will show the battery as being fully charged. That is because the converter in supplying 13.4 volts to the battery. The panel meter sees that as being more than the 12V it expects, therefore the battery must be full.
The panel reading is only somewhat accurate once shore power has been removed for a while.
